Rebelo AR, Buttler E, Aguilera Nunez E, Cronk B, P. Isolation of Infectious Highly Pathogenic Avian Influenza A(H5N1) Virus from Fetal Bovine Serum, United States, 2025. Emerg Infect Dis. 2026 Aug
In February 2025, a lot of FBS was received by the Virology Laboratory at the Cornell Animal Health Diagnostic Center (AHDC; Ithaca, NY, USA) for routine extraneous agents testing, per requirements of Title 9 of the Code of Federal Regulations (9CFR) for animal origin biologic products (§113.53, §113.46, §113.47). The tested FBS consisted of a pool of samples collected in 5 states (Pennsylvania, Kansas, Nebraska, South Carolina, and California). We tested the sample as prescribed in 9CFR, by seeding Vero cells (ATCC CCL-81) and primary fetal bovine kidney (FBK) cells, developed by the AHDC Virology Laboratory, in T75 tissue culture flasks in Eagle minimum essential medium supplemented with 2% penicillin/streptomycin and 15% (final concentration) of the test FBS sample. We maintained cells for 7 days and monitored for cytopathology. FBK cells did not exhibit viral cytopathic effect (CPE) but were positive for noncytopathic bovine viral diarrhea virus through virus-specific immunofluorescence assay (IFA) staining on day 7. We observed CPE in Vero cells on day 7 post-inoculation. Subsequent IFA testing of the Vero cells was negative for the bovine viruses listed in 9CFR (i.e., bovine viral diarrhea virus, bovine parvovirus, bluetongue virus, reovirus, bovine adenovirus, bovine respiratory syncytial virus, and rabies virus). We tested FBK and Vero cells cultured in the presence of 15% control gamma-irradiated FBS in accordance with 9CFR regulations; the cells remained negative for CPE and IFA virus.
